Description
(Default) Runs POST following a FRU replacement or an AC
power cycle.
Runs POST on all resets.
Runs POST on all error resets.
Runs POST on every power on.
Does not run POST on reset.
Runs the maximum set of tests.
Runs the minimum set of tests.
(Default) Displays the minimum level of output.
Displays information for each step.
Displays a moderate amount of information, including
component names and test results.
Displays extensive debugging information.
Disables the output.
(Default) Runs the maximum set of tests.
Runs the minimum set of tests.
(Default) Displays the minimum level of output.
Displays information for each step.
Displays a moderate amount of information, including
component names and test results.
Displays extensive debugging information.
Disables the output.
(Default) Runs the maximum set of tests.
Runs a minimum set of tests.
(Default) Displays the minimum level of output.
Displays information for each step.
Displays a moderate amount of information, including
component names and test results.
Displays extensive debugging information.
Disables the output.
Displays all test and informational messages in POST output.
Displays functional tests with a banner and pinwheel in POST
output.
Displays all test, informational, and some debugging messages
in POST output.
Displays extensive debugging information.
Does not display POST output.
